Hearth And Home Update

The first and long-awaited Hearth and Home content patch to the hit indie game, Valheim, finally has a release date!

What We Know So Far

Valheim’s Hearth and Home update will be hitting Steam on September 16th for fans to enjoy.

The first major content patch to the game will focus on new items to build for your base for the most part, as the name implies.

In their previous update, Iron Gate announced stackable gold coins as well as some new iron bars to go with your iron gate (get it?).

With the date announcement, we also got a teaser of two new items coming to the game. One is a wooden wolf head that can be added to your buildings to give them a bit of a Nordic feel.

The second item teased is a new furnace/stove. I would guess that this is some form of a new workbench, but there is no way to be certain. Even if it is just a cosmetic item, it will still spice up any home, especially those mountain bases.
